Can small businesses run Google Ads like enterprise brands?

In this episode, we break down why applying enterprise-level PPC strategy to a small service-based business can actually destroy performance.

After managing multimillion-dollar budgets for brands like Toyota, Sage, and AM/PM, I’ve seen firsthand how differently enterprise accounts operate compared to small businesses spending under $20,000 per month. Enterprise campaigns focus on market share, impression share, and brand visibility. Small businesses, on the other hand, must focus on profitability, qualified leads, and predictable revenue.

We cover the major strategic differences in budget allocation, automation, risk tolerance, attribution, and funnel strategy — and why chasing visibility instead of revenue is one of the biggest mistakes small advertisers make.

If you’re a service-based business owner trying to scale with Google Ads, this episode will help you build a strategy that fits your budget, your goals, and your stage of growth — instead of copying tactics designed for billion-dollar brands.
